Abstract

A single or multiple lumen catheter is disclosed which includes an expandable lumen. The expandable lumen is movable from a collapsed or sealed configuration to an open or expanded configuration. In the open configuration, the expandable lumen is dimensioned to receive a guidewire or stylet or facilitate the introduction of fluids into a patient.

Claims (15)

1. A method of manufacturing a multi-lumen catheter, the method comprising the following steps:

extruding a catheter body having a first lumen and a second lumen and a septum separating the first lumen from the second lumen, the septum including a removable material positioned within and extending along the length of the septum, wherein the septum is extruded from an elastomeric material; and

removing the removable material from the septum to define a slit which extends through the septum along the length of the septum, the slit being expandable from a normally closed or normally substantially closed configuration to an expanded configuration to define a third lumen.

2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the step of removing the removable material from the septum includes pulling the removable material from the septum.

3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the removable material is a dissolvable or degradable material and the step of removing the removable material from the septum includes exposing the catheter to a solvent to dissolve or degrade the removable material within the septum.

4. The method according to claim 3 , further including the following step:

flushing the third lumen to remove the dissolved/degraded material from the third lumen.

5. The method according to claim 2 , wherein the removable material comprises a polymer.

6. The method according to claim 2 , wherein removing the removable material from the septum includes exposing the catheter body to a solvent to swell the catheter body prior to pulling the removable material from the septum.

7. The method according to claim 3 , wherein exposing the catheter to the solvent comprises dipping the catheter body in the solvent.

8.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the first lumen and the second lumen have equal cross-sectional areas.

9.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the first lumen and the second lumen have different cross-sectional areas.

10. The method according to claim 1 , wherein extruding the catheter body comprises extruding the catheter body from at least one of polyurethane, a thermoplastic material, a polyolefin, a fluoropolymer, a polyvinyl chlorideneoprene (PVC), or a silicone elastomer of a fluoroelasatomer.

11.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the elastomeric material is different from a material from which a portion of the catheter body defining the first and second lumens is extruded.

12.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the elastomeric material has a lower coefficient of friction than a material from which a portion of the catheter body defining the first and second lumens is extruded.
